👉 Screen computing refers to the interaction between users and digital interfaces, primarily through screens like monitors, tablets, or smartphones. It encompasses a broad range of activities, including visual input, output, and interaction, where the screen serves as the primary medium for communication, information processing, and task execution. This paradigm integrates human-computer interaction principles with graphical user interfaces (GUIs), touchscreens, and augmented reality to create immersive and intuitive experiences. Screen computing leverages technologies such as graphics processing units (GPUs), virtual reality (VR), and artificial intelligence (AI) to enhance user engagement, improve accessibility, and facilitate complex data manipulation. It plays a crucial role in modern computing environments, from personal devices to enterprise systems, by enabling seamless and efficient interaction between humans and digital systems.
